Nature of request
[Louther] requests that a commission is granted to Hungerford, Flore, Louther, Merbury, Russell, Alisaundre and Neuton to hold the sessions in Wales, namely at Cantref Selyf, the quorum being Flore, Louther, Merbury, Russell, Alisaundre and Neuton.

Note
The petition dates to? 1422-? 1424 as other petitions originally from Chancery Files 548 appear date to these years based on the dating assigned them on the guard. In addition, the petition is addressed to the bishop of Durham, then chancellor, and Thomas Langley was chancellor from July 1417 to July 1424. For a wider discussion of the dating of this petition see Rees (Petitions Relating to Wales, pp.482-3).
